What are the KR Series Non-Flammable Wire Wound Resistors?


The KR is a range of high-power wire wound resistors designed for heavy-duty power dissipation in industrial equipment where safety and long-term structural integrity under sustained thermal load are paramount. The defining characteristic of the series is its non-flammable housing, which encases the wire wound resistive element in a ceramic body that will not ignite or sustain combustion even under fault conditions or prolonged overloading. This property makes the KR series suitable for installation inside enclosed panels, cabinets, and equipment housings where the use of a component that could act as an ignition source would be unacceptable under safety regulations or insurance requirements.

Power ratings span from 120W to 600W, placing the KR series firmly in the high-power dissipation bracket and distinguishing it from the lower-rated ceramic encased families in the RQB, RQL, and AQL series. The resistance range of 0.02Ω to 20Ω is deliberately narrow and concentrated at the low end of the ohmic scale, reflecting the series’ primary function as a high-current, low-resistance power dissipation element rather than a general-purpose resistance component. At these low values and high power ratings, the KR is suited to carrying large continuous or pulsed currents while limiting voltage across the element to a manageable level. Tolerance is ±10%, which is consistent with the series’ role in power dissipation and braking duties where exact resistance values are less critical than thermal robustness and current-carrying capacity.

The temperature coefficient of resistance is specified at 400ppm/°C maximum, acknowledging that at high continuous dissipation levels the element will operate at elevated temperatures and that some resistance drift with temperature is inherent to the wire wound construction at this power level. The insulation resistance of 20MΩ minimum ensures adequate electrical isolation between the resistive element and the chassis or mounting hardware, confirming suitability for line-voltage industrial environments. The combination of a non-flammable ceramic enclosure, low resistance range, high power rating, and robust wire wound construction makes the KR a reliable long-life component for sustained power dissipation duties where safety compliance and structural durability are the primary design requirements.

Applications of the KR Series Non-Flammable Wire Wound Resistors


Where RARA wire wound resistors are deployed in the field.


The KR series is suited to high-power industrial applications requiring non-flammable resistors in the 120W to 600W range at low resistance values. Primary uses include dynamic braking resistors in variable speed motor drives and crane hoist drives, where kinetic energy recovered during deceleration must be dissipated as heat safely within the drive enclosure.
Discharge resistors in large DC bus capacitor banks in inverters, converters, and UPS systems, where rapid and reliable energy removal on shutdown is required; current-limiting and inrush protection resistors in high-current AC and DC industrial circuits; load resistors in generator and alternator load testing equipment, where continuous high-power dissipation over extended test periods is required; and neutral grounding and earthing resistors in medium-voltage distribution and industrial power systems where low-resistance, high-power elements must perform reliably over decades of service.
The non-flammable ceramic enclosure also makes the KR well suited to safety-critical installations in rail traction systems, mining equipment, offshore and marine power panels, and any enclosed industrial environment where component combustibility is subject to regulatory or certification requirements.
